The investment required to open a CPR Services Franchise is between $13,300 - $16,900 . There is an initial franchise fee of $7,500 which grants you the license to run a business under the CPR Services name.

Training
Your four (4) days of formal training at our home office and learning center is designed to get you and your business up and running within your first 90-120 days. The formal training includes:
* CPR instructor Training
* First Aid Instructor Training
* Accounting and Record Keeping
* Sales and Marketing techniques
* Ongoing Training
In addition to consistent updates, you will have the opportunity to develop relationships with other CPR Services' Franchises and share new and fresh ideas -- helping expand everyone's client base. Periodic training conferences will also give you the opportunity to learn new skills, meet your peers, and help improve your business.
